Based on checking the website Aquaearth.us, the site appears to be a legitimate e-commerce platform specializing in shower water purification products and bidets.

The overall impression suggests a functional store, but a deeper dive reveals several areas where it falls short of what a truly trusted and professional online presence should offer, particularly from an ethical standpoint and for consumer confidence.

Here’s an overall review summary:

  • Website Presence: Functional, but lacks comprehensive information typically found on reputable e-commerce sites.
  • Product Clarity: Products are listed with descriptions, but details on filtration efficacy and certifications are sparse.
  • Trust Signals: Limited trust badges, no clear return policy, warranty, or detailed contact information.
  • Customer Support: “Contact us quick and easy” is mentioned, but specific methods phone, email are not immediately apparent.
  • Ethical Considerations: While the products shower filters, bidets are generally permissible, the website’s lack of transparency in crucial areas like detailed policies and robust customer support information raises flags for consumer trust.

Aquaearth.us Pricing

Understanding the pricing structure of Aquaearth.us involves looking at the individual product listings on their homepage.

The website prominently features sale prices for almost all its products, indicating a strategy focused on perceived value and discounts.

Current Product Pricing Overview

The homepage displays several products with both an original price and a discounted “Current price.” This is a common e-commerce tactic to encourage immediate purchases by highlighting savings. Hollidaycottages.com Review

  • 15 Stage Filter Replacement Cartridges Mega Pack: Original price $37.84, now $27.84
  • 15-Stage Shower Head Set: Original price $58.84, now $32.84
  • 15-Stage Vitamin C Shower Filter: Original price $48.84, now $28.84
  • Black Shower Head Filter For Hard Water: Original price $42.84, now $31.84
  • 15-Stage Replacement Cartridge: Original price $12.84, now $10.84
  • Bronze Shower Head Filter For Hard Water: Original price $42.84, now $31.84
  • Shower Head with Fixed High-Pressure Rainfall: Original price $25.34, now $16.34
  • Gold Shower Head Filter For Hard Water: Original price $42.84, now $31.84
  • Luxury Bidet Sprayer Set: Original price $38.84, now $28.84

Pricing Strategy and Value Proposition

The consistent discounting suggests that the listed “original prices” might serve as a psychological anchor, making the “current prices” appear more appealing.

This is a standard marketing practice, but without clear comparisons to market averages or direct competitor pricing, it’s hard to definitively assess the actual value.

  • Affordable Pricing Claim: The website states, “We provide top-tier water filtration solutions at competitive prices, making clean water accessible without breaking the bank.” The displayed prices do seem to align with this claim, positioning them as a budget-friendly option in the shower filtration market.
  • Replacement Cartridge Costs: For filter systems, the cost of replacement cartridges is a critical long-term expense. Aquaearth.us offers a 15-Stage Replacement Cartridge for $10.84 and a Mega Pack for $27.84. This seems relatively affordable, but the frequency of replacement which isn’t clearly stated on the homepage will dictate the true ongoing cost. Industry standards suggest shower filter cartridges should be replaced every 3-6 months, depending on water quality and usage.

Aquaearth.us vs. Competitors

When evaluating Aquaearth.us, it’s essential to benchmark its offerings and online presence against established competitors in the water filtration and bidet market.

While Aquaearth.us aims for affordability and simplicity, more reputable brands often excel in transparency, customer support, and product certifications, which are crucial for consumer confidence.

Transparency and Trust Signals

  • Aquaearth.us: Lacks clear policies returns, privacy, terms, detailed contact info beyond a generic “Contact us,” and third-party product certifications. Testimonials appear generic. The heavy reliance on “Buy on Amazon” suggests they lean on Amazon’s trust infrastructure rather than building their own robust trust signals on their direct site.
  • Established Competitors e.g., Brita, Culligan, Waterpik: These brands universally provide easily accessible, detailed legal policies, multiple contact options phone, email, chat, and prominently display recognized certifications e.g., NSF/ANSI standards for filtration. Their “About Us” sections are usually comprehensive, and testimonials are often linked to verifiable sources or established review platforms. This level of transparency is non-negotiable for consumer-facing businesses in regulated industries.
    • Data Point: According to a 2023 study by Statista, 88% of consumers consider transparency from brands to be either “very important” or “extremely important” when making purchase decisions.

Product Range and Specialization

  • Aquaearth.us: Highly specialized in shower filters and bidets. This narrow focus could be seen as a strength, implying deep expertise in these specific areas.
  • Established Competitors:
    • Water Filtration Brita, Culligan: Often offer a broader spectrum of filtration solutions, including pitcher filters, faucet filters, under-sink systems, and whole-house filters, in addition to shower filters. This broader range caters to diverse customer needs.
    • Bidet Market Kohler, Bio Bidet: While some large bathroom fixture companies like Kohler offer bidets as part of a wider product line, specialized bidet companies like Bio Bidet offer an extensive range of features, from basic attachments to advanced smart bidets with heating, drying, and customization options.

Pricing and Value Proposition

  • Aquaearth.us: Positions itself as an affordable option, with consistent sales and competitive pricing on its limited product range.
  • Established Competitors: Pricing varies widely.
    • Value Brands: Some competitors offer similar entry-level products at comparable or slightly higher prices, but often with the backing of stronger brand recognition and customer support.
    • Premium Brands: Brands like Berkey for filters or Kohler for bidets typically have higher price points, justified by superior build quality, advanced features, longer warranties, and often, independent performance validation. Consumers often pay a premium for verified performance and reliability.

Customer Support and Engagement

  • Aquaearth.us: Claims “Customer Service: Contact us quick and easy” but provides no immediate means to do so on the homepage. The lack of an FAQ section means basic queries would need direct outreach.
  • Established Competitors: Invest heavily in comprehensive customer support. This includes:
    • Multi-channel support: Phone, email, live chat.
    • Extensive FAQ sections: Covering installation, troubleshooting, maintenance, and warranty.
    • Online resources: Blogs, video tutorials, and user manuals.
    • Data Point: A report by Zendesk indicates that 66% of customers use three or more channels to contact customer service, highlighting the importance of diverse support options.
